Coach's Corner: Wakefield Hosts Falls Church at Homecoming

Warriors (0-6) face Jaguars (1-5) tonight.

The Wakefield High School Warriors are looking for their first win of the season tonight during their homecoming game against the Falls Church Jaguars. "Every week we've been getting a little better, though the scores aren't necessarily showing it," Wakefield Assistant Head Coach Mike Warden said. "We've got a pretty good feeling, I think we'll do pretty well." The Warriors are 0-6; the Jaguars, 1-5. In mid-September, the Jaguars scored their first win since 2010. Warden said his team has been watching video of the Falls Church team, looking for weaknesses that can be exploited and strengths that need to be prepared for. "We're looking for both," Warden said. Coach's Corner: Washington-Lee Hosts Wakefield at Homecoming

Generals (2-2) play the Warriors (0-4) tonight.

After four hard weeks, the Wakefield High School Warriors will play Washington-Lee on Friday at the Generals' homecoming game. Wakefield is 0-4 so far this season, but the team has been getting better each week, Assistant Head Coach Mike Warden said. "Those guys are really good. They're coached well. We've been watching them on film, and they're a very impressive team. It's going to be their homecoming, so it'll be an emotionally full night. It'll be tough," Warden said. "We've got to put all that stuff aside. We know they're coming ready to play. So we've got to come ready to play, too. And we've shown improvement each week. So, we play as hard as we can."
